Press Release - Constitutional amendments now being pushed through People's Initiative, threat to 'checks and balance' in gov't -- Bong Go

In an ambush interview on Wednesday, January 24, after attending the 42nd anniversary celebration of the Lung Center of the Philippines, Senator Christopher "Bong" Go expressed his strong opposition to the ongoing People's Initiative, highlighting a united front from the Senate and raising concerns about the implications for the Filipino people and the country's democratic framework.

Go elaborated on the unanimous decision by the Senate against the ongoing People's Initiative through a manifesto signed by all of the senators on Tuesday.

"Unanimously, 24-0 pumirma po sa manifesto... lahat po ng senador ay tutol dito sa People's Initiative dahil alam naman natin na, I'm sure, na hindi po na-explain nang mabuti sa publiko yan kung ano yung napapaloob do'n sa pinapapirma sa kanila," said Go.

The senator emphasized the importance of safeguarding the constitution and the Senate as an institution, to ensure there are 'checks and balances' in government. He added that any proposed amendment to the constitution must focus on the welfare of ordinary Filipino citizens and not for political gain of anyone.

"Protect the constitution, the Senate as an institution, and our democracy. Protect the will of the people, protect the interest of the people," he asserted.

"Unahin po natin ang interes ng ordinaryong mamamayang Pilipino. Hindi po ang pulitiko ang dapat na makikinabang dito. That has been my position at hindi po nagbago yan. Unahin po natin ang interes ng mga mahihirap nating kababayan." he added.

The Senate manifesto emphasizes the risks associated with the current PI's proposal that the Senate and the House of Representatives vote jointly rather than separately as a constituent assembly on constitutional amendments.

"Kung ang nakalagay doon is voting jointly na po ang gagawin, papano po yung checks and balances ng gobyerno," he questioned.

Go also emphasized the critical yet equal roles of the Lower House and the Upper House which is the Senate in the legislative process of the Philippines. "Kaya nga po tayo may Lower House, kaya nga po mayroon tayong Senado para kapag ipinasa ang batas, o yung bill sa Lower House ay may magtse-check rin po sa Senado," he stated.
